The Thrilling Clash Between LSG and RCB: Who Will Seal Qualifier 1 Spot?
The stage is set for an exhilarating showdown between two of the IPL’s most formidable teams, Lucknow Super Giants (LSG) and Royal Challengers Bengaluru (RCB), as they face off in the final league match of IPL 2025. The stakes are high, with RCB fighting to seal a top-two finish and a Qualifier 1 berth, while LSG is playing for pride in their last home game.

Rishabh Pant’s Uncharacteristic Form
One player who is sure to be under scrutiny is LSG captain Rishabh Pant, whose form has been in question all season. Despite his impressive batting skills, he has struggled to find consistency, scoring only 151 runs in 13 matches at a strike rate of just 107. Virat Kohli’s Record-Breaking Pursuit
On the other hand, RCB stalwart Virat Kohli is on the cusp of breaking two massive records in IPL history. With 24 runs away from becoming the first-ever player to score 9,000 runs for one franchise, and just one half-century shy of registering the most fifties in IPL history (currently tied with David Warner), Kohli’s performance will be crucial in determining RCB’s fate.
